Key differences

Both FFND and AAUS are equity ETFs. FFND charges 1.00% a year and AAUS 0.15%. The main difference: FFND covers global markets; AAUS covers North America.

  • FFND covers global markets; AAUS covers North America.
  • AAUS costs 0.85% less per year.
  • AAUS is much larger than FFND. Larger funds are usually more liquid and less likely to close.
